Job Title: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) CoordinatorJob Description

The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Coordinator supports safety and compliance initiatives across multiple construction projects. This role helps build and maintain a strong safety culture by conducting site inspections, facilitating training activities, ensuring OSHA and Cal/OSHA compliance, investigating incidents, and assisting with environmental and regulatory requirements. The EHS Coordinator plays a key role in documenting safety performance, supporting project teams, and promoting safe work practices on all job sites.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ct routine jobsite safety inspections and audits across multiple construction projects.
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A, Cal/OSHA, and internal safety standards and procedures.
  • Monitor subcontractor safety performance and verify adherence to safety requirements.
  • Assist in developing and implementing project-specific safety plans and procedures.
  • Maintain Safety Data Sheets (SDS) and hazardous material documentation in an organized and accessible manner.
  • Track and report safety metrics, observations, and corrective actions to support continuous improvement.
  • Maintain accurate safety records and compliance documentation for all projects.
  • Track employee training records and certifications to ensure requirements remain current.
  • Prepare clear and timely safety reports for management and project teams.
  • Assist with regulatory inspections and audits by providing documentation and supporting onsite activities.
  • Participate in safety meetings and contribute to discussions on risk mitigation and best practices.
  • Support data entry and reporting related to inspections, incidents, and safety performance.
  • Collaborate with construction teams to identify hazards and communicate corrective actions effectively.

Essential Skills

  • At least 2 years of experience in a construction, industrial, environmental, or safety-related role.
  • Working knowledge of OSHA and Cal/OSHA regulations and their application on construction sites.
  • Strong communication skills to clearly convey safety expectations and corrective actions.
  • Strong organizational skills to manage documentation, records, and reporting requirements.
  • Ability to conduct field inspections on active construction sites and follow up on corrective actions.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, including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• Ability to interpret safety standards and apply them to practical field conditions.
  • Attention to detail when tracking safety metrics, training records, and compliance documentation.

Work Environment

This role operates primarily within active construction environments, requiring regular field presence for jobsite inspections and audits. The EHS Coordinator works closely with project teams, subcontractors, and management, attending meetings and supporting safety-related discussions. The position involves frequent use of standard office technologies, including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ook, to maintain records, track training, and prepare reports. The work environment combines on-site fieldwork with office-based documentation and reporting, and may involve navigating uneven terrain, exposure to typical construction site conditions, and adherence to standard safety attire and personal protective equipment requirements.
